ZTS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2023 in Review

1,556 of the 6,275 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Zoetis (ZTS) for Q1 2023, worth a combined $70.9B — up 14% from $62.2B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 166 funds opened new ZTS positions and 95 closed out — a net gain of 71 holders — while 623 added to existing stakes and 540 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Vanguard Group, adding an estimated $479M. The largest seller was Winslow Capital Management, cutting an estimated $360M.
